The Minnesota Wild's four-game winning streak and superior 44-21-12 record propelled trader consensus toward them as heavy favorites against the Seattle Kraken, who entered on a six-game skid with a 32-33-11 mark and fading playoff hopes in the Pacific Division. Playing at home in St. Paul, the Wild leveraged their 8-1-1 edge in the last 10 head-to-heads, overcoming early deficits behind Joel Eriksson Ek's three points and Vladimir Tarasenko's go-ahead goal in a 5-2 victory. Kraken injuries, including Shane Wright (upper body, out until at least April 9), day-to-day goalie Philipp Grubauer (lower body), and indefinite absences for Jaden Schwartz, compounded their struggles against Minnesota's momentum heading into a key Central Division clash with Dallas.
